Wood window services encompass a range of solutions aimed at maintaining, repairing, and restoring traditional wooden windows. These services typically involve assessing the condition of existing wood frames and sashes, addressing issues such as rot, decay, and warping, and performing necessary repairs or replacements. Skilled professionals may also provide refinishing options, including sanding, staining, and sealing, to enhance the appearance and durability of wood windows. Proper maintenance through these services can help extend the lifespan of wooden windows and preserve the aesthetic appeal of the property.
One of the primary problems that wood window services help resolve is deterioration caused by exposure to moisture and environmental elements. Over time, wood can develop rot, mold, or insect damage, which compromises the structural integrity and insulation properties of the window. Additionally, issues like cracked or broken glass, deteriorated paint or finish, and loose or damaged hardware can affect the functionality and energy efficiency of the window. Addressing these problems through professional repair or restoration can improve a building's comfort, reduce energy costs, and prevent further structural damage.

Replacement Costs - Replacing wood windows typically ranges from $300 to $1,000 per window, depending on size and style. For example, a standard-sized window may cost around $500 for installation. Costs can vary based on the complexity of the project and local labor rates.
Repair Expenses - Repairing wood windows often falls between $150 and $500 per window. Common repairs include replacing rotted wood or restoring damaged frames, with prices influenced by the extent of damage and window accessibility. Local pros can assess the specific needs for an accurate estimate.
Refinishing and Restoration - Refinishing wood windows typically costs between $200 and $600 per window. This includes sanding, staining, and sealing to restore appearance and functionality. The cost varies based on the condition of the existing wood and the desired finish quality.
Additional Service Fees - Extra services such as custom modifications or hardware replacement may add $100 to $400 per window. These costs depend on the scope of work and specific customer preferences, with local service providers offering detailed quotes after assessment.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
